Dreht euch nicht um – der Golem geht rum (1971)
Plot Summary
In the 23rd century, it is no longer necessary to work thanks to the latest technology. Convicts do the work that still needs to be done. The World Leisure Center uses a computer system to decide how people spend their free time. World citizen number DARK 7035 7201 is called Prun. Although an examination shows that his IQ is too low for him to have a child of his own, he becomes the father of Botho. Because it is a "black birth", he has to keep Botho hidden from now on. Prun comes into contact with the so-called "semi-intelligentsia", who oppose the government.
